‘Lord’ Trailer, Web Site Debut

Movie fans will get their first opportunity this weekend to view the “Lord of the Rings,” the trilogy that’s already one of the most anticipated films of the year.

The trailer for the film, based on J.R.R. Tolkien’s fantasy epic, will screen in theaters beginning Friday before the showing of the Kevin Costner starrer “Thirteen Days.”

New Line Cinema, which released the Cuban Missile Crisis drama, is also making “Lord.” The first part of the film stars Elijah Wood, Cate Blanchett, Ian McKellen, Ian Holm and Liv Tyler.

Friday also marks the kick-off day for the launch of www.lordofthering.net, the official Web site to the film, which will include video and audio clips, an interactive map of Middle Earth, chat rooms, screen savers and interviews with the cast members.
